If $795.60 represents 12% of Inga's monthly income, how much is 60% of Inga's monthly income?

Let Inga's monthly income be $x.

Since $795.60 represents 12% of Inga's monthly income, then we can set up the equation: 0.12x = $795.60.
Solving for x gives: x = $795.60 / 0.12 = $6630.
Therefore, 60% of Inga's monthly income is 0.6 * $6630 = $<<0.6*6630=3978>>3978. Answer: \boxed{3978}.
